Asana Lab

Module 01

Asana Lab

In person · 40 hours · Summer 2026

The physical practice, studied in full. Asana Lab is a 40-hour deep dive into the poses themselves — how they work, why they work, what they demand of the body, and what to look for when you're teaching or practicing. We tackle alignment, Sanskrit, the muscles involved, energetics, and the common tendencies that show up in students and in ourselves. You'll leave with a grounded, embodied knowledge of the physical practice that goes far beyond what most YTTs cover.

What We Cover
Alignment principles across all pose families
Sanskrit names and their meaning
Primary muscles engaged per pose
Energetic properties and intentions
In-person demos and hands-on exploration
Common student tendencies and mistakes
Modifications and contraindications
What to look for when observing students
Props and how to use them effectively
100+ poses covered in full
This module is for anyone who wants to go deeper into the physical practice — whether you're curious about teaching one day, a dedicated practitioner who wants to truly understand the poses, or someone not yet ready to commit to a full YTT.

Subtle Body

Module 03

Subtle Body

Synchronous hybrid · 15 hours · November 2026

Beneath the physical practice is an energetic one. This 15-hour module explores the subtle body — the layers of being, the energy centers, the breath pathways, and the nervous system at the root of transformation. These are the concepts that give yoga its depth and distinguish a class that feels like a workout from one that feels like a reset. Whether you teach or simply practice, this module changes how you experience the mat.

What We Cover
Koshas — the five layers of being
Chakras — energy centers and their significance
Nadis and pranic pathways
Introduction to prana
Vayus — the five directional energies
Pranayama practices
Meditation techniques
Energetics of asana
Nervous system regulation
Holding space for transformation
Yoga Nidra foundations
For practitioners who want to understand why yoga works — and teachers who want to offer more than a physical experience.

Foundations

Module 05

Foundations

Mostly async virtual + 5 hours in person · 20 hours

Where did yoga come from? What does it actually teach? And what does the PLAYLIST approach to this practice look like? This 20-hour foundations module answers all of it — tracing yoga from the Vedas to the modern studio, exploring the philosophical texts that underpin the practice, and giving you a relationship with yoga that goes beyond the mat. Delivered mostly on your own time, with an in-person session to bring it to life.

What We Cover
What is yoga?
History: Vedas, Upanishads, Vedanta, Classical, Hatha, Modern
The eight limbs of yoga
Styles of yoga and lineages
Sanskrit foundations and common terms
Breath awareness and intro to pranayama
Meditation fundamentals
Yoga as practice vs. performance
PLAYLIST methodology and teaching philosophy
Self-reflection, personal practice, and journaling
Yoga Sutras of Patanjali
Bhagavad Gita overview
Yamas and Niyamas
For anyone who wants to understand yoga more deeply — not just as movement, but as a living practice and philosophy.
